“Alarming”: Armenia scores low on corruption index

According to the Transparency International Corruption Perception Index (CPI) for 2005, Armenia is one of 70 countries (of 159 surveyed) in which the level of corruption is “alarming”.

The Transparency International (www.transparency.org) index of corruption reflects the views of local and foreign businesspeople and analysts, and is based on the results of 16 public opinion surveys conducted by 10 independent research centers.
